Bibio roehli

Insecta - Diptera - Bibionidae

Taxonomy
Bibio roehli was named by Statz (1943). Its type specimen is LACMIP 3367, an exoskeleton, and it is a compression fossil. Its type locality is Rott (Statz Collection), which is in a Chattian lacustrine - small shale in the Rott Formation of Germany.
